Meridith invites Jose Rodriguez to discuss—and debunk—9 common Emergency Medical Dispatch misconceptions. In this episode, they cover:
1. The caller is too upset to respond accurately.
2. The caller doesn’t know the required
information.
3. The dispatcher is too busy to waste time asking
questions, giving instructions, or flipping through card files.
4. The medical expertise of the dispatcher is not
important.
